Tree crown shaping services involve the careful pruning and trimming of a tree’s uppermost branches to achieve a desired form or size. This process typically includes removing dead, damaged, or overgrown limbs to promote a more balanced and aesthetically pleasing appearance. Crown shaping can also help improve the overall structure of the tree, encouraging healthy growth and reducing the risk of branch failure. Professionals utilize specialized techniques to ensure that the natural shape of the tree is maintained while addressing specific landscape or safety concerns.

One of the primary issues addressed through crown shaping is the management of overgrown or unruly branches that may interfere with structures, power lines, or pedestrian pathways. Overgrown crowns can also lead to uneven weight distribution, increasing the likelihood of branch breakage during storms or high winds. By selectively trimming the canopy, service providers help mitigate these risks and enhance the safety of the property. Additionally, crown shaping can improve light penetration and airflow within the tree, contributing to its overall health and vitality.

Basic Crown Shaping - Typically costs between $200 and $500 for standard tree crown shaping services. Prices vary depending on the tree size and complexity of the shaping work involved.

Moderate Crown Reshaping - Expect to pay approximately $500 to $1,200 for more detailed crown shaping on medium to large trees. The cost depends on the extent of pruning required and tree accessibility.

Advanced Crown Shaping - Costs generally range from $1,200 to $2,500 for complex shaping projects on mature or large trees. Additional charges may apply for specialized equipment or difficult-to-reach branches.

Custom Crown Design - Custom shaping services can vary widely, with prices starting around $2,500 and going upward based on the scope and intricacy of the design. Local pros provide tailored estimates based on spec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Tree Crown Thinning is a technique used to reduce density within the canopy, allowing more light and air to reach the interior branches. Specialists can perform thinning to promote overall tree vitality.

Tree Crown Reduction services involve reducing the height or spread of a tree's crown to prevent interference with structures or power lines. Experienced contractors can safely perform crown reductions to maintain safety and aesthetics.

Tree Crown Reshaping focuses on restoring or modifying the shape of a tree's crown for improved visual appeal or structural health. Local arborists can tailor reshaping to suit specific landscape needs.

Selective Crown Pruning involves removing specific branches to enhance tree structure and prevent potential hazards. Skilled service providers can carry out precise pruning to support tree longevity.

What is tree crown shaping? Tree crown shaping involves pruning and trimming trees to improve their appearance, structure, and health.

How can tree crown shaping benefit my trees? Proper shaping can enhance aesthetic appeal, reduce risk of limb failure, and promote better growth patterns.

When is the best time to have tree crown shaping done? The ideal timing depends on the tree species and local climate, but it is often performed during dormancy or early growth seasons.

Are there different techniques used in tree crown shaping? Yes, techniques vary and may include crown thinning, crown raising, and crown reduction, tailored to each tree’s needs.
